apach + php +mysql

Добрый день…Помогите…
Поставил апач, пхп мускул…
emerge apache php mysql

Но появились проблемы…никак не могу ничего создать ни переместить в каталог /var/www/localhost
И во вторых никак не могу получить доступ мускулу…При вводе в консоле mysql выводиться : ERROR 2002 (HY000): Can’t connect to local MySQL server through socket ‘/var/run/mysqld/mysqld.sock’ (2)

Прошу помочь…

1. Проблемы скорей всего в правах доступа к /var/www/localhost
2. Видимо не запущен mysqld (/etc/init.d/mysql start). Если запущен, то ps -A | grep mysql должно его показать.
Кроме установки mysql надо конфигурить и запускать. И потом включить автозапуск (rc-update)

А скажите как пользователю добавить права доступа к /var/www/localhost
И если есть возможность расскажите подробнее на счет конфигурирования mysql

Вот что выдаёт при попытке запуска Mysql помогите разобраться…
/etc/init.d/mysql start
Starting …
MySQL datadir is empty or invalid
Please check your my.cnf : /etc/mysql/my.cnf [ !! ]
ERROR: mysql failed to start

Помогите хоть кто нибудь решить сложившуюся проблему, неужели никто не занимался поднятием php apach mysql???

Руководство по MySQL для начинающих
http://www.gentoo.org/doc/ru/mysql-howto.xml
Установка Apache2
http://ru.gentoo-wiki.com/wiki/%D0%A3%D … B0_Apache2

Спасибо…С mysql разобрался, а вот на счет апача все так и стоит…нет доступа к нему и все…Подскажите, может доступ к апачу надо в правах пользователя прописать??

у меня обратная ситуация сначала поставил апатч далее mysql а вот php не устанавливается, причем на с помощъю emerge php ни с помощью emerge mod_php помогите плииизззз может кто сделает пошаговый how to по установки компанентов web сервера

сделайте так:

# emerge php | wgetpaste
# emerge --info | wgetpaste

Полученные 2 ссылки опубликуйте тут - так Вам быстрее смогут помочь.

Возможно дело в USE флагах - добавьте в /etc/make.conf флаг php к USE переменной

USE=“php” (если php нужно поддерживать во всех программах по умолчанию)

или
если нужно только для установки данной программы

USE=“php” emerge php

при вводе выдает ссылку следующую Your paste can be seen here: http://paste.pocoo.org/show/354464/
при вводе emerge --info | wgetpast Your paste can be seen here: http://paste.pocoo.org/show/354466/
php установился, после того как добавил флаг к use еще и xml
USE=“php xml” emerge php в etc/make.conf
установлилось вроде все корректно, но вот только phpmyadmin не запускается пакет вроде установился а вот по ссылке localhost/phpmyadmin страница не найдена.
решение вновь было не таким замысловатым как на первый взгляд, просто скачать дистрибутив последний phpmyadmin и распаковать его в /var/www/localhost/htdocs/phpmyadmin , затем создать каталог config (/var/www/localhost/htdocs/phpmyadmin/config) и в нем создать файл config.inc.php Далее после запуска апача в браузере ввести http://127.0.0.1/phpmyadmin/setup/ после чего следуя мастеру ввести пароль и прочие параметры.